系统过滤器ActionName过滤器

[ActionName("Test")]

替换第一个视图为Test

在使用原视图会找不到路径相当于Index视图被覆盖了。

把路径改为Test则可查看(前提有创建的Test视图)

[NonAction]

NonAction标记一个Action只是一个普通方法不作为mvcAction

[RequireHttps]

强制使用HTTPS重新发送请求

ValidateInput 过滤器

[ValidateInput(true/false)]

该Action是否过滤Html等危险代码

OutputCache过滤器

用于缓存查询结果,这样可以提高用户体验,也可以减少查询次数,Duration:缓存时间

[OutputCache(Duration =10)]设置缓存时间为10秒

VaryByParam :表示以哪个字段为标识来缓存数据例如name字段

[OutputCache(Duration =10 ,VaryByParam ="name")]

如果name变了不管时间到没到都会刷新

c#mvc过滤器之系统过滤器相关推荐

  1. asp.net core MVC 过滤器之ActionFilter过滤器(二)

    简介 Action过滤器将在controller的Action执行之前和之后执行相应的方法. 实现一个自定义Action过滤器 自定义一个全局异常过滤器需要实现IActionFilter接口 publ ...

  2. asp.net core MVC 过滤器之ExceptionFilter过滤器(一)

    简介 异常过滤器,顾名思义,就是当程序发生异常时所使用的过滤器.用于在系统出现未捕获异常时的处理. 实现一个自定义异常过滤器 自定义一个异常过滤器需要实现IExceptionFilter接口 publ ...

  3. PHP过滤器之审查过滤器(Sanitize filters)

    今天我们继续谈一谈PHP的过滤器的审查过滤器部分 警告:当使用这些过滤器可以通过ini文件或者通过您的Web服务器的配置,一个默认的过滤器的警告,默认标志设置为filter_flag_no_encod ...

  4. Asp.Net MVC 3【Filters(过滤器)】

    这里分享MVC里的Filters(过滤器),什么是MVC里的过滤器,他的作用是什么? 过滤器的请求处理管道中注入额外的逻辑.他们提供了一个简单而优雅的方式来实现横切关注点.这个术语是指所有对应用程序的 ...

  5. MVC 自带的过滤器 使用

    MVC全局过滤器 过滤器:过滤器的作用顾名思义就是过滤掉一些东西.例如高速公路的检查站一样,只有符合条件的才能上高速,不符合条件的则不能上高速.MVC的过滤器作用就类似高速公路的检查站.而全局的过滤器 ...

  6. ASP.NET MVC使用Bootstrap系统(2)——使用Bootstrap CSS和HTML元素

    ASP.NET MVC使用Bootstrap系统(2)--使用Bootstrap CSS和HTML元素 阅读目录 Bootstrap 栅格(Grid)系统 Bootstrap HTML元素 Boots ...

  7. 5分钟Serverless实践 | 构建无服务器的敏感词过滤后端系统

    前言 在上一篇"5分钟Serverless实践"系列文章中,我们介绍了什么是Serverless,以及如何构建一个无服务器的图片鉴黄Web应用,本文将延续这个话题,以敏感词过滤为例 ...

  8. ASP.NET MVC Controller激活系统详解:默认实现

    Controller激活系统最终通过注册的ControllerFactory创建相应的Conroller对象,如果没有对ControllerFactory类型或者类型进行显式注册(通过调用当前Cont ...

  9. ELK --- Grok正则过滤Linux系统登录日志

    过滤Linux系统登录日志/var/log/secure 登陆成功 Jan 6 17:11:47 localhost sshd[3324]: Received disconnect from 172. ...

最新文章

  1. 在x86上成功使用gentoo系统上安装的grub2启动 Mac OS X Leopard 10.5.7
  2. LeetCode-Unique Binary Search Trees
  3. 全球及中国食品色素行业供应前景与发展趋势研究报告2022版
  4. 前端学习(2837):image图片标签
  5. python安装软件win10_在win10上安装Python和Tensorflow
  6. 前端用户体验提升系列(一)最常见的用户体验指标和提升方式
  7. 机器学习常见概率模型
  8. gmod服务器文件,gmod服务器里改名字指令 | 手游网游页游攻略大全
  9. igraph基本使用方法示例
  10. 计算机网络设置端口转发,怎么设置路由器端口转发功能?
  11. 计算机教师继续教育心得,教师继续教育学习培训心得体会(精选5篇)
  12. 辛苦编码好几年,一朝栽在算法前
  13. 测试开发之路-我的处女作
  14. window7系统的电脑如何调节亮度?
  15. ref、reactive、toRef、toRefs的区别
  16. 输入一个字符串,字符串长度大于6,让黄灯长亮,否则一直闪烁
  17. 设计模式(二)—— 创建型模式
  18. 【Pytorch】AWSnet论文解读与实验复现
  19. 德州仪器工业4.0产品组合
  20. 理解偏差和方差(Bias-Variance)的Tradeoff

热门文章

  1. 手机画画,随时随地满足你的绘画欲望
  2. 有哪些顶级水平的中国程序员?
  3. 1.7亿次接力 百度知道成雷锋精神新载体
  4. CC2640R2F BLE5.0 蓝牙协议栈信道选择算法#2(CSA#2)
  5. QT(5.14.2) 部分文档中文译文
  6. 【win11】Y9000P 2022款 升级22H2
  7. Android重力感应SensorEventListener详解
  8. Unity 阻止手机熄屏
  9. 物联网工程实践日报表10
  10. git提交代码出现错误remote: [31mx-oauth-basic: Incorrect username or password (access token)